The Excavation Process in Mount Sterling
Excavation adapts to the project type and what the site currently presents. New construction lot preparation in Mount Sterling moves through clearing, topsoil removal, cut-and-fill grading, and compaction before foundation work begins. Utility trenching follows routing plans to maintain required depths and avoid conflicts with other underground installations. Each project phase connects to the next when sequencing is planned correctly from the start.
- Site walk and assessment in Mount Sterling identifying terrain, drainage flow, and underground utility locations before any ground disturbance begins
- Topsoil stripping that keeps organic material separated from structural fill, preventing decomposition voids beneath concrete, foundations, and septic components
- Cut-and-fill grading matched to design elevations, balancing material on-site where possible to reduce hauling on Montgomery County's sloped lots
- Trench excavation at specified depths for septic tanks, distribution boxes, water lines, and drainage installations, respecting required code clearances
- Fill placement and compaction in eight-inch lifts, reaching design density before the next lift or any surface installation begins above it

Results Mount Sterling Property Owners See from Site Preparation
Ground preparation outcomes in Mount Sterling depend on site conditions and how preparation addresses them. When specific variables are handled correctly during excavation, the effects carry through every construction phase that follows.
- When topsoil is stripped and stockpiled before grading, concrete slabs and foundations don't develop voids from decomposing organic material underneath them over time
- If fill is compacted in lifts rather than pushed in loose, driveways and pads remain level rather than settling unevenly during the first season after installation
- When trench backfill is compacted properly around utility lines, buried components maintain depth and slope rather than migrating as ground settles around them
- If drain field grades are established during excavation, septic systems flow by gravity without requiring pumps to supplement flow from an undersized or poorly graded installation
- When surface drainage is graded before concrete arrives in Mount Sterling, spring runoff moves away from slabs rather than pooling where it undermines base material
